You’re here for Tableau Developers.
We’re here to help you find top talent, fast.
Get matched to 3 highly-qualified Tableau Developers minutes.Hire Top Tableau Developers
How you hire Top Tableau Developers at Braintrust
Post a job
Create an account and publish your job posting free of charge.
Manage and hire top talent instantly.
Get to work
We simplify onboarding, invoicing, compliance, and more.
Proudly trusted by
Our talent is unmatched.
We only accept top tier talent, so you know you’re hiring the best.
We give you a quality guarantee.
Each hire comes with a 100% satisfaction guarantee for 30 days.
We eliminate high markups.
While others mark up talent by up to 70%, we charge a flat-rate of 15%.
We help you hire fast.
We’ll match you with highly qualified talent instantly.
We’re cost effective.
Without high-markups, you can make your budget go 3-4x further.
Our platform is user-owned.
Our talent own the network and get to keep 100% of what they earn.
How to hire Top Tableau Developers
Hiring a Tableau Developer requires considering a wide array of factors that cover both technical and non-technical skills. This role requires expertise in Tableau, data analysis, understanding of databases and data warehousing concepts. Additionally, problem-solving abilities, communication skills, experience with other visualization tools, and a strong understanding of the business domain are also crucial.
When hiring for a startup versus a larger company, the scope and responsibilities of the role can differ significantly. In a startup, a Tableau Developer may be expected to wear multiple hats, not only creating and managing visualizations but also handling raw data extraction, data-driven modeling, data integration, data science, and sometimes even database management. The data scientist might have to work with less structured data and limited resources, requiring more innovative problem-solving. In contrast, in a larger company, the role could be more specialized, focusing primarily on visualization, while other aspects like data extraction and warehousing are handled by separate teams. Large organizations might also have more established data governance, business processes, and quality assurance processes in place.
The choice between hiring a full-time employee versus a part-time employee or hourly contractor also depends on the organization's needs. Full-time employees are typically preferred when the need for data visualization is consistent and long-term, requiring ongoing software development and maintenance of Tableau interactive dashboards and Tableau public. Full-time employees can also be more integrated into the company culture and strategic initiatives.
On the other hand, hiring an hourly contractor could be a good choice for short-term projects or when the workload varies significantly over time. Contractors might also bring a broader range of experiences from working with various clients. However, managing contractors requires strong project management skills to ensure that work is completed on time and within budget.
In either case, it is important to clearly define the role, responsibilities, and expectations before hiring. A detailed job description can help attract the right candidates, and a thorough interview process, including technical assessments and problem-solving exercises, can help assess their skills and fit for the role. It's also essential to consider the candidate's adaptability, especially given the fast-evolving landscape of data analytics, web development, automation, machine learning, and business intelligence. The right candidate will be someone who is not only qualified for the current job but is also capable of growing and evolving with the role and the organization.
Understanding of Data Warehousing Concepts
A Tableau developer should be well-versed in data warehousing concepts. They should understand the architecture of a data warehouse and the principles behind its design, including fact and dimension tables, star schema, and snowflake schema. They should be comfortable with ETL processes, which are used to extract data from various sources, transform it into a suitable format, and load it into a data warehouse. Proficiency in using ETL tools such as Informatica, Talend, or SSIS can be a significant advantage. Understanding OLAP operations like roll-up, drill-down, slicing, and dicing is also essential to interact effectively with data stored in a warehouse.
Proficient Tableau developers should excel in agile problem-solving, as they often need to troubleshoot issues related to data quality, software functionality, and visualization accuracy. They should be able to identify problems, investigate the causes, and come up with effective solutions. This requires strong analytical skills and a meticulous approach to work. A good understanding of data quality management and data governance principles can help in identifying and rectifying data issues. Furthermore, developers should be comfortable using debugging and troubleshooting tools. Familiarity with version control systems like Git can also be beneficial, as these systems allow developers to track changes and roll back to previous states if problems occur.
Good communication skills are crucial for a Tableau developer. They often need to work closely with various stakeholders, including data engineers, data analysts, project managers, and business leaders. They need to explain complex data and visualizations in a way that non-technical stakeholders can understand. This requires a strong command of both written and spoken language. Additionally, good presentation skills are important, as developers may need to present and explain their visualizations in meetings or workshops. Understanding how to use collaboration tools like Slack, Microsoft Teams, or Jira for effective team communication can also be beneficial.
Experience with Other Visualization Tools
Understanding the business domain they are working in can make a Tableau developer much more effective. This enables them to design visualizations that provide meaningful insights and directly address business concerns. They should be able to work with business leaders to identify key performance indicators (KPIs) and other metrics that are critical to business success. A strong Tableau developer should be able to understand and interpret business requirements and translate them into technical requirements. Familiarity with business intelligence concepts and tools can also be beneficial. For instance, knowledge of key BI methodologies, such as the Balanced Scorecard or SWOT analysis, can help in aligning data analysis with strategic business goals.
Frequently Asked Questions
What are the skills needed for a Tableau Developer?
A Tableau Developer requires a combination of technical and non-technical skills. They need proficiency in Tableau software, including its advanced features. Software engineers should have strong data analysis skills, and a good understanding of databases, including the ability to write SQL queries. Knowledge of data warehousing concepts is also crucial. In terms of non-technical skills, they need problem-solving abilities to troubleshoot issues, and strong communication skills to explain complex data visualizations to non-technical stakeholders. Experience with other data visualization tools and an understanding of the business domain are also beneficial.
How much does it cost to hire Tableau Developers?
The pricing of hiring a Tableau Developer can vary significantly depending on factors such as the developer's years of experience, the complexity and duration of the project, and the geographic location. The annual salary for a Tableau Developer in the U.S. could range from $70,000 to over $120,000. Since then, these rates may have changed. Companies also need to consider additional costs such as benefits, taxes, and training when hiring a full-time employee.
Where can I hire a Tableau Developer?
Tableau Developers can be hired through various channels. Traditional job boards and tech-focused job sites like Braintrust is a good places to start. Freelance platforms like Braintrust can be useful for finding contract Tableau developers. Additionally, you could consider posting the job opening on Tableau's own community forums, but using Braintrust makes it easy to find the best match for you.
How do I recruit a Tableau Developer?
Recruiting a Tableau Developer involves clearly defining the role, responsibilities, and skills required, and then advertising the job on suitable platforms. You should screen candidates based on their CVs and cover letters, then conduct interviews and technical assessments to evaluate their Tableau skills, problem-solving abilities, and cultural fit. You might ask them to demonstrate their abilities by creating a sample Tableau dashboard or visualization. Checking references can provide insights into their past performance and reliability.
How much does a Tableau Developer charge per hour?
The hourly rate for a Tableau Developer can greatly vary depending on the individual's experience, expertise, and location. A Tableau Developer in the U.S. might charge anywhere from $40 to $100 or more per hour. These rates may change! Contractors or freelancers might have different rates than those working full-time. Rates might also be higher for short-term projects or projects requiring specialized skills or quick turnaround.
What does a Tableau Developer do?
A Tableau Developer designs and creates data visualization solutions using Tableau software. These professionals interact with various databases to extract the required data, clean and organize it, and then use Tableau to visualize it in a way that provides meaningful insights. They create dashboards, charts, graphs, and other visual tools to help stakeholders understand complex data sets and derive actionable insights. They may also be responsible for maintaining and troubleshooting these visualizations, as well as training other development team members to use them effectively.
Is coding required in Tableau?
Is SQL required for Tableau?
SQL isn't strictly necessary for creating basic visualizations in Tableau, but a strong understanding of SQL can significantly enhance a Tableau Developer's capabilities. This is because Tableau often sources data from SQL databases, and being able to write SQL queries allows for more control over data extraction and manipulation. This can be especially useful for dealing with complex or large datasets. Furthermore, understanding SQL can aid in troubleshooting data-related issues, optimizing performance, and ensuring the accuracy of visualizations. So, while not a must, SQL skills are highly beneficial for a Tableau Developer.
Get matched with Top Tableau Developers instantly 🥳Hire Top Tableau Developers